OverviewLearn to style for advertisements, magazines and portfolios and take your first steps into one of fashion communication's most dynamic and rewarding careers. With hands-on practical advice on working as part of a team, developing a visual vocabulary and managing a shoot, you'll be encouraged to experiment and develop your own original creative concepts. This revised edition includes a new chapter on the future of the industry, exploring how the role is changing and the stylist's position as an entrepreneur. There are also new interviews with professional stylists and 120 new images to demonstrate each technique. Prior to her career in education, Jacqueline worked in the industry in fashion promotion. She also works as a freelance stylist, styling editorial and commercial projects, events and exhibitions. Sophie Benson is an Associate Lecturer on the Fashion Communication degree course at Liverpool John Moores University, UK. She previously worked as a freelance stylist and is now a freelance journalist covering sustainable fashion for publications including The Guardian, Dazed and AnOther. Clare Buckley is Course Leader for Fashion Styling and Production at the London College of Fashion, University of the Arts London, UK.
